引言
jQuery 是一个广泛使用的 JavaScript 库,它简化了 HTML 文档遍历、事件处理、动画和 Ajax 交互。随着技术的不断发展,jQuery 也不断更新迭代。本文将为你汇总一些学习 jQuery 最新版的在线资源,并解析一些实用的技巧。
在线资源汇总
1. 官方文档
jQuery 的官方网站提供了最权威的学习资源。你可以在 jQuery 官方文档 中找到最新的 API 文档、教程和示例。
2. 在线教程
- MDN Web Docs:提供了丰富的 jQuery 教程和参考文档,适合初学者和进阶者。
- w3schools:这个网站提供了简单的 jQuery 教程,适合初学者快速入门。
3. 视频教程
- YouTube:在 YouTube 上,你可以找到许多免费的 jQuery 教程视频,从基础到高级都有。
- Udemy:Udemy 提供了付费的 jQuery 课程,内容丰富,适合有系统学习需求的人。
4. 社区论坛
- Stack Overflow:在 Stack Overflow 上,你可以提问和回答 jQuery 相关的问题。
- jQuery 中文论坛:这是一个中文社区,你可以在这里找到许多 jQuery 相关的资源。
实用技巧解析
1. 选择器优化
jQuery 选择器是进行 DOM 操作的关键。以下是一些优化选择器的技巧:
- 使用 ID 选择器,因为它是最快的。
- 尽量避免使用复杂的选择器,如
.class > .class。 - 使用
.find()方法来查找子元素,而不是使用多级选择器。
2. 事件委托
事件委托是一种提高性能的技术,它允许你将事件监听器绑定到父元素上,而不是每个子元素上。以下是一个示例:
$(document).on('click', '.button', function() {
// 处理点击事件
});
3. 动画与过渡
jQuery 提供了强大的动画和过渡功能。以下是一些常用的动画技巧:
- 使用
.animate()方法来创建动画。 - 使用
.css()方法来改变元素的样式。 - 使用
.fadeIn()、.fadeOut()、.slideToggle()等方法来创建过渡效果。
4. Ajax 请求
jQuery 的 Ajax 方法使得发送 HTTP 请求变得非常简单。以下是一个示例:
$.ajax({
url: 'example.com/data',
type: 'GET',
success: function(data) {
// 处理响应数据
},
error: function() {
// 处理错误
}
});
总结
学习 jQuery 最新版需要不断实践和探索。通过以上提供的在线资源和实用技巧,相信你能够更快地掌握 jQuery。记住,多动手实践,多查阅文档,多参与社区讨论,你将不断进步。
